About the position

At Gap Inc., we believe in bridging the gaps in the world through our diverse brands, including Old Navy, Athleta, Banana Republic, and Gap. As a Global Security Operations Analyst, you will play a crucial role in embodying our core value of 'Do The Right Thing' by ensuring the safety of our people, assets, and brands. This position is set in a dynamic and fast-paced environment where your primary focus will be to create a secure atmosphere for our employees, teams, and customers. Your efforts will be vital in driving our Brand Power and fostering enduring customer relationships, all while upholding our commitment to our team and values. In this role, you will support Asset Protection strategies and processes with a customer-centric mindset, aiming to deliver results that drive store sales and maximize operational efficiencies. You will be responsible for the effective execution of Asset Protection measures to safeguard our stores and distribution centers. Your ability to identify and mitigate risks in an evolving business landscape will be essential. You will leverage data from process evaluations and brand research to influence investigative directions and management decisions. Your responsibilities will also include facilitating the daily operations of the Global Security Operations Center (GSOC), which encompasses a variety of tasks such as risk intelligence, incident and crisis management, emergency communication, and ensuring supply chain resilience. You will actively participate in the intelligence function, preparing and distributing global risk intelligence products to identify and mitigate potential business risks. Constant vigilance is key, as you will monitor open-source intelligence, social media platforms, and specialized internal tools for threats to our employees, assets, and brand reputation. Additionally, you will track global geopolitical events that may impact executive travel or company operations, providing timely reports as necessary. In the event of life safety incidents, you will take the lead in coordinating responses, ensuring the safety and security of all involved.
